Stop the Stigma 5K
Walk/Run for Interfaith Social ServicesApr 27, 2019 from 8:30 AM to 12:30 PM
On Saturday, April 27, Interfaith Social Services is hosting the 45th Annual Stop the Stigma 5K to support our loved ones who are affected by mental illness and addiction. Through the event, we hope to challenge stereotypes, encourage acceptance and eliminate stigma associated with mental illness. All funds from this event support Interfaith's New Directions Counseling Center. New Directions offers compassionate and skilled counseling to to everyone, including those who would otherwise not be able to afford mental health counseling.
The 5K route features beautiful views of the Boston skyline as seen from the Squantum and Marina Bay regions of Quincy, MA. There will be post-race festivities which will include games and activities, a Kids' Fun Run, food, music, raffles and much more!
